- On 12 July 1982, ARDC was merged into a newly formed apex rural credit institution.
Concept / ApproachNABARD was set up in 1982 as the apex development bank for agriculture and rural development. ARDC’s refinance functions were subsumed into NABARD at inception.
Final AnswerARDC was merged into NABARD.
